Muriel M. Yates

June 23, 1913 — February 7, 2009

Muriel M. Yates, age 95, of Rigby, died Saturday, February 7, 2009, at Homestead Assisted Living of Rigby. Muriel was born June 23, 1913 at Brigham City, Utah a daughter to James Newberry Morris and Betsey Scholes Morris. She graduated from Logan High School and attended Utah State University. She married Thomas Harper Yates March 22, 1934 in the Logan Utah LDS Temple. She taught piano lessons in her home and was a substitute teacher for the Rigby School district. As an active member of The Church of Jesus Christ of Latter-day Saints she served in all church auxiliary organizations: stake and ward primary, young women’s, relief society as chorister of ward and stake singing mothers, ward organist and chorister. She served a mission in the Washington D.C. Mission from 1981 to 1982, and was a temple ordinance worker. She was a member of the Daughters of the Utah Pioneers. She is survived by her children: Beverly Clark of Rigby, Joseph Richard (Lib) Yates of Durham, North Carolina, Patricia (Errol) Smith of Ucon, Judith Decker of Midvale, Utah, Sheila (Richard) Adams of North Ogden, Utah, Morris Harper Yates of Blackfoot, 25 grandchildren and 50 great grandchildren. She was preceded in death by her parents, her husband Thomas Harper Yates in 1980, a sister Iva Basinger and 2 grandchildren, and 2 great-grandchildren. Funeral services will be held Thursday, February 12, 2009 at 11:00 a.m. at the Rigby East Stake Center (4021 East 300 North) with Bishop Wayne Call officiating. The family will visit with friends on Wednesday evening from 7:00 to 8:30 p.m. at Eckersell Memorial Chapel in Rigby and on Thursday from 9:30 to 10:45 a.m. at the Stake Center. Burial will be in the Rigby Pioneer Cemetery.
